NOVA and PBS Digital Studios bring the magic of the molecules to life in an exciting new nine-episode digital series, Out of Our Elements. Across the series, hosts Arlo Pérez and Caitlin Saks meet with a diverse set of chemistry experts to explore the surprising molecular connections of the everyday world we experience.
